Rosberg takes second successive Monaco pole

ico Rosberg took his second successive Monaco Grand Prix pole position during Saturday's qualifying hour. The German set a 1:15.989 during the opening set of Q3 runs to edge out Mercedes team-mate Lewis Hamilton, before an error on his final lap brought out the yellow flags and prevented any improvements.More to follow.Sunday's 78-lap race in Monaco gets underway at 2pm local time (GMT +2)
